... Read moreTraveling off-grid in a caravan offers incredible freedom and adventure, but it also brings unexpected challenges, especially when illness strikes far from medical help. Gastrointestinal issues can quickly turn a fun trip into a tough ordeal for the whole family. From personal experience, being prepared with the right supplies and knowledge makes all the difference. When gastro hit my family during an off-grid caravan trip, it wasn’t just the physical symptoms that were hard to manage but also keeping spirits high in cramped quarters. We found that having basic medical supplies—such as oral rehydration salts, anti-diarrheal medication, and plenty of clean water—was critical. Sanitizing hands regularly and maintaining good hygiene helped prevent the spread within the close space of the caravan. Planning your route with accessible healthcare points in mind, even if you prioritize remote locations, can ease anxiety if someone falls ill. Also, carrying nutritious, easy-to-digest food and stockpiling some comfort foods helped us get through the toughest hours. Despite the hardships, such experiences bring valuable insights about resilience and adaptability while travelling Australia as a full-time family. The unpredictability of off-grid living teaches you to stay calm, be resourceful, and appreciate moments of wellness even more. Ultimately, with proper preparation and a positive mindset, managing gastro and other illnesses while on the road can be part of the unique adventure of life in a caravan.
